Abstract
An improved spacecraft ordnance system includes a plurality of squibs each connected with a resistor having a squib unique resistance value and a driver unit including built-in test circuitry. Ordnance harness cables connect the squibs with the driver unit. The resistors enable squib identification. The built-in test circuitry enables unambiguous verification of correct connection of each squib with the driver unit. The built-in test circuitry includes a low-impedance multiplexer for selecting a driver line for monitoring, a precision current source for providing a relatively low current to a selected output of the driver unit producing a voltage proportional to the total resistance from signal to ground, and a analog/digital converter for digitizing the voltage and reporting the result to a computer for comparison to predicted values using a telemetry interface and therefore identifying the selected squib. An EMI-tight adapter housing the squib-specific resistor may be attached to the squib.
